Ruslan Shestopalyuk 09ad0cc0c6 Implement reporting of events from native side to WebPerformance API (#35768)
Summary:
Pull Request resolved: https://github.com/facebook/react-native/pull/35768

Changelog: [Internal]

This implements native side mechanics for reporting user events timing to JS  (PerformanceObserver API).

See the standard for more details: https://www.w3.org/TR/event-timing/

The events are only logged when there are any active subscriptions (via `PerformanceObserver.observe`), also we only log "discrete events" (i.e. no likes of mouse move), so the overhead is non-existing.

There are two main metrics of interest for an event lifecycle:
* Time the event is spent in the queue, i.e. the time between it's created and dispatched
* Time that is spend in the event handler on the JS side (event dispatch), or processing time

Both of these are measured, and the corresponding fields are populated.

/*
* Copyright (c) Meta Platforms, Inc. and affiliates.
*
* This source code is licensed under the MIT license found in the
* LICENSE file in the root directory of this source tree.
*/
#pragma once
#include <FBReactNativeSpec/FBReactNativeSpecJSI.h>
#include <functional>
#include <optional>
#include <string>
#include <vector>
namespace facebook::react {
class PerformanceEntryReporter;
#pragma mark - Structs
using RawPerformanceEntry = NativePerformanceObserverCxxBaseRawPerformanceEntry<
std::string,
int32_t,
double,
double,
// For "event" entries only:
std::optional<double>,
std::optional<double>,
std::optional<uint32_t>>;
template <>
struct Bridging<RawPerformanceEntry>
: NativePerformanceObserverCxxBaseRawPerformanceEntryBridging<
std::string,
int32_t,
double,
double,
std::optional<double>,
std::optional<double>,
std::optional<uint32_t>> {};
using GetPendingEntriesResult =
NativePerformanceObserverCxxBaseGetPendingEntriesResult<
std::vector<RawPerformanceEntry>,
uint32_t>;
template <>
struct Bridging<GetPendingEntriesResult>
: NativePerformanceObserverCxxBaseGetPendingEntriesResultBridging<
std::vector<RawPerformanceEntry>,
uint32_t> {};
#pragma mark - implementation
class NativePerformanceObserver
: public NativePerformanceObserverCxxSpec<NativePerformanceObserver>,
std::enable_shared_from_this<NativePerformanceObserver> {
public:
NativePerformanceObserver(std::shared_ptr<CallInvoker> jsInvoker);
~NativePerformanceObserver();
void startReporting(jsi::Runtime &rt, std::string entryType);
void stopReporting(jsi::Runtime &rt, std::string entryType);
GetPendingEntriesResult popPendingEntries(jsi::Runtime &rt);
void setOnPerformanceEntryCallback(
jsi::Runtime &rt,
std::optional<AsyncCallback<>> callback);
private:
};
} // namespace facebook::react
